*T007: Chronologic Constraints on the Processes and Tempos of Orogenesis
Archived in Sedimentary Basins*

Session Description:
The contents of sedimentary basins reflect the product of both tectonic and
climatically mediated surface processes, and thus provide an exceptional
archive of changes, perturbations, and interactions between these earth
systems over geologic time. Advances in geochronology and thermochronology
applied to sedimentary basin deposits have led to unprecedented temporal
resolution of proxies linked to surface processes and tectonics including
sedimentation and erosion rates, unroofing patterns, orogenic exhumation,
and changes in paleogeography and river network geometry. Increasing
geographic/stratigraphic coverage with these methods presents new
opportunities to identify and quantify processes driven by tectonics and/or
surface processes that are universal across orogenic systems. This session
seeks contributions that employ geochronological and thermochronological
data from sedimentary basins and/or numerical approaches to investigate
orogenic processes. We particularly encourage applications that have
implications for the broader tectonics community including basin analysis,
structural geology, geomorphology, and geophysics.
